Mahindra Holidays appoints S Krishnan as new CFO

Mahindra Holidays and Resorts India Ltd, the country’s largest vacation ownership company and part of $15.9 billion Mahindra Group, has appointed S Krishnan as the new chief financial officer (CFO) of the company effective from January 1, 2014, the firm said in a BSE filing.

Krishnan will replace Aloke Ghosh, who has now resigned from the services of the company. Krishnan is a chartered accountant with over 25 years of experience and has held various positions in Mahindra Group in the past. His previous stint was with Mahindra Satyam as the chief financial officer.

In December this year, the firm divested stake in two Austria-based companies. The company informed that BAH Hotelanlagen AG and MHR Hotel Management GmbH will no longer be subsidiaries of the company.

The company owns and operates a number of resorts in countries outside India, including Thailand and Malaysia.

Earlier this year, in its bid to increase its presence overseas, the company acquired a 49 per cent stake in Dubai-based Arabian Dreams Hotel Apartments – a 75-room property.

Mahindra Holidays, which runs hotels and resorts under the Club Mahindra brand, has an inventory of 2,480 rooms among 44 resorts in India and overseas.

The company reported an 11 per cent increase in income at Rs 165 crore and a 12 per cent increase in profit after tax at Rs 27 crore year on year for the quarter ended September 30, 2013.
